What’s Exporting?
In Godot, exporting a venture is the method of packaging your venture together with a binary that accommodates the Godot engine code. The binary is compiled in another way for every goal platform, permitting your venture to run on techniques that don’t have Godot put in.
Each supported platform has its personal export template, which is a group of information Godot makes use of to package deal and debug your exported venture. They’re important as a result of they include the Godot engine code compiled for every goal platform, permitting your venture to run on techniques that don’t have Godot put in.
With the binaries in hand, you possibly can then distribute your venture on platforms like Steam, itch.io, the App Retailer and Google Play.
Getting the Export Templates
If that is the primary time you’re exporting for the model of Godot you’re utilizing, you’ll have to obtain and set up the export templates.
You’ll be able to verify when you have the templates put in by deciding on Editor ▸ Handle Export Templates within the prime menu.
This may open the Export Template Supervisor, a small software to handle your export templates.
On the prime left, you possibly can see the model of Godot you’re utilizing; 4.3.secure in my case.
In case you don’t have the export templates put in but, you’ll see a pink textual content seem subsequent the model as is the case within the screenshot above. To put in the lacking templates, click on the Obtain and Set up button on the prime proper.
Doing so will obtain the templates for the model of Godot you’re utilizing and set up them regionally.
As soon as the obtain finishes, you possibly can see the place Godot put in your new export templates.
Observe: When you’ve got export templates put in within the Different Put in Variations part for a model of Godot you’re not planning on utilizing anymore, click on the garbage can icon subsequent to the model identify to delete them and get well some disk area.

Export Settings
Time to take a better have a look at the varied settings Godot presents you with for exports.
Shared Choices
First up are the shared choices on the prime, this consists of the Identify and Export Path fields. These are the identical for all platforms.
From prime to backside, the choices are as follows:
- Identify: A reputation to your export preset. That is helpful as you possibly can configure completely different presets for a similar platform, so the completely different names make it simpler to differentiate between them.
- Superior Choices: For some platforms like Android and iOS, further choices can be found. Toggling this on will present choices meant for energy customers.
- Runnable: If checked, this can allow one-click deploy for the export preset, enabling you to shortly deploy the preset by way of a single button click on. The precise perform of one-click deploy will depend on the platform. For desktop platforms like Linux, macOS and Home windows, it lets you deploy exports over SSH as soon as configured. For cellular platforms like Android and iOS, it lets you set up the export in your gadget or emulator. Lastly, for net exports, it is going to begin an area net server and host the exported venture. For extra data on one-click deploy, see Godot’s One-click deploy documentation.
- Export Path: The file path the place the venture might be exported to.
Choices Tab
Subsequent, check out the Choices tab.
Once more, from prime to backside, the choices are as follows:
- Customized Template: Right here you possibly can set a path to customized export templates for each the Debug and Launch exports. In case you compiled your individual export templates from the engine supply code, you possibly can set them right here. This can be utilized to optimize your exports for measurement or velocity by stripping out the 3D engine for instance.
- Export Console Wrapper: When enabled, an additional executable might be included subsequent to the exported venture that may run your venture within the console. That is helpful for debugging and testing your venture.
- Embed PCK: A PCK file is an archive file just like a ZIP. It bundles the venture’s property like scripts, scenes and textures collectively in a single file. If allow this setting, the PCK file might be embedded within the exported venture as a substitute of being a separate file.
- Structure: This units the CPU structure of the exported venture. On desktop platforms, the most typical CPU structure is x86_64, which is the 64-bit model of x86. I like to recommend leaving this on the default worth. The export templates that Godot offers solely help the x86_32 and x86_64 architectures. If that you must export for a special structure, you’ll have to construct your individual export template. You will discover extra information on that on the Constructing from supply web page.
- Texture Format: With these, you possibly can select how textures are saved. Each choices right here mix two texture codecs into one. The S3TC and BPTC codecs are primarily used for desktop platforms and consoles, whereas ETC2 and ASTC are used for cellular platforms, embedded gadgets and the online.
- SSH Distant Deploy: This selection lets you deploy your exported venture over SSH. This may be helpful to check your venture on a distant machine.
